Meta-analysis of COVID-19 prevalence during preoperative COVID-19 screening in asymptomatic patients
Objectives Patients with COVID-19 may be asymptomatic and are able to transmit COVID-19 during a surgical procedure, resulting in increased pressure on healthcare and reduced control of COVID-19 spread.
